[ ] Turnstile upgrade — Day 1. The old Gatewick barriers at Harrowfield House are decommissioned. New Spindrel lanes read badges on the left panel only. Tap once; do not wave. If the lane flashes amber, step back and retry. Wheelchair gate is the far-right lane, staffed until the sensor retrofit finishes. Report faults to the facilities desk, not reception. Until your permanent badge arrives from Corvane Systems, use the temporary pass code below at the keypad.

door code, yagap-bahof: bdg-O-05

Handover — Gross-Margin Review

From: H. Ostrander. To: L. Quayle. Margin review on the Pellwright line is half done. Freight allocations restated through Q2; Q3 pending. Watch the rebate accruals — they were understated last cycle. Workpapers in the finance shared drive, folder marked GM-Review. Flag anomalies above two points to me directly. Broader implications are noted below.

confidential, kagup-bafog: Fraaxax Group is in early talks to buy Soroxox Group for about $343.8 million. The Olidor launch date is June 14, and nothing goes to the press before then. Legal wants the Aldmirek Logistics term sheet signed before July 23.

## Runbook: Stallmark Occupancy Feed

The Stallmark feed publishes per-level occupancy counts for the Verewood garage network every thirty seconds. If counters freeze or report negative spaces, restart the aggregator first, then the gateway — order matters, since the gateway replays stale snapshots on boot. Before restarting anything, confirm the aggregator is running with the expected settings. The current production configuration is reproduced below.

deployment values, yadup-kadug:
[sorys]
port = 5672
team = noveth
host = sorys.orvexcorp.example
region = south-4
access_code = ac_deddc1
timeout_ms = 1500

# Build provenance — Gatewren health checks

Plugins deployed behind the Gatewren load balancer must answer the `/healthz` probe within 800ms. Failing probes pull the node from rotation; provenance records stay attached to the delisted build. Do not spoof probe responses — provenance verification compares the responding binary's digest against the registry. Unsigned builds are rejected at registration. Verify your artifact by matching it against the trace token issued below.

build token for haduf-bafog: htk21_2d98ce91a83676b65394a